General Optimization Design Research of Metallic Materials to Resist Cavitation Erosion and Abrasion

Wang Biao,Zhang Zihua,Wang Yudong

Strategic Study of CAE 2000, Volume 2, Issue 2,   Pages 64-67

Abstract:

For the design optimization of erosion and abrasion resisting metallic materials basic study and productively applied research were conducted. Basic study indicates that W, Co and Cr have better erosion and abrasion resisting property than other ones among ten useful constructive metals. Productively applied researche indicates that thermal sprayed WC- M hard faced ceramics in the tungsten parental materials, rare earth plating chromium in the chromium parental materials, and CoCrWC hard faced ceramic in the cobalt parental materials are better erosion and abrasion resisting materials with high performance and low cost.
